Technical specialist, access transport

Sydney
Singtel Group
Posted: 29 April
Offer description

Optus is an Australian telecommunications company, delivering more than 11 million services to our customers every day across mobile, broadband and digital solutions.

The Access Transmission Team designs, plans, and manages capacity for the Optus Mobile Access Transport Network, including cell site routers and microwave links, ensuring reliable delivery of mobile services through detailed design, testing, and implementation. This role provides technical leadership across IP modernisation, resiliency, and RAN initiatives to deliver a robust, resilient, and future‐ready metro and regional transport network.

Your day to day will consist of

* Lead CSR deployment across metro and regional networks, ensuring delivery aligns with schedules and applying dual‐homing and optimised aggregation to minimise outage risk.
* Own technical planning for Greenfield, IBC, Stay Alive, and 5G Upgrade programs, translating RAN requirements into end‐to‐end transmission delivery and modernisation plans.
* Identify transmission dependencies and coordinate new builds or upgrades to enable timely, resilient mobile network expansion.
* Act as senior escalation point for fault resolution and performance optimisation, ensuring high network resiliency and service continuity.
* Drive automation, process optimisation, and engineering improvements to deliver future‐ready and robust connectivity.
* Work closely with leadership, Network Deployment, Operations, IP Transport teams, and Access Network Planning to align strategy, execute AOP programs, and improve customer experience.

What makes you perfect for the role

* Tertiary qualification in Electrical or Telecommunications Engineering with 5–7 years' experience in telecoms design, planning, or provisioning roles.
* Strong engineering knowledge across mobile access transport technologies, particularly Microwave and Fibre Transmission, with experience delivering large‐scale telco networks.
* Ability to assess business impacts of technical solutions, perform trade‐offs, and support TCO development for new opportunities.
* Solid troubleshooting skills with the ability to identify, own, and resolve issues efficiently.
* Minimum 3 years' experience leading technical teams; self‐driven, proactive, and able to work autonomously while exercising sound judgement.
* Effective communicator able to engage technical and non‐technical stakeholders, build strong cross‐functional relationships, and ensure on‐time delivery.
* Advanced Microsoft Office proficiency with the ability to develop complex capacity forecasting models.
